Sista:
Fix mapping back from inline cache tags to classes on 32-bit Spur where, because SmallIntegers are 31 bits (tag = 1, not 01), Character (tag = 10) gets mapped to 0.

Cogit PC Mapping:
Fix testBcToMcPcMappingForCogMethod: now that dead codee removal can eliminate blocks that are unreachable.
